Tiltrotor aircraft is a new type of aircraft.which combined and has the advantages ofconventional helicopter with fixed-wing aircraft.It has been one of the hot sop of aeronauticsField.The coupling of the wing and rotor of tiltrotor aircraft is more complicated than helicopter.Whirl flutter is the most serious problem when tiltrotor is forward flighting in airplane mode and is amain factor that affects the speed of forward flight.There are two parts of this paper. In first section,a aeroelastic dynamical model of wing/nacelle/rotor couple system is founded to study the influences rotor and dynamic parameters on whirl flutterof tilt-rotor in cruise flight.The model is based on Hamilton’s principle and the multi-bodymethod.Based on the model,the influence of the coupling between flap and pitch,the coning angle ofhub,the stiffness of wing, the forward-swept of wing are studied.Based on the calculated results of first part,a light semi-span tiltrotor model is designed. Therequirement for wind speed is lifted and the phenomena of tiltrotor aircraft’s whirl flutter can beobserved. To farther testify the correctness of the theory, a kinetics experiment is designed preparingfor future study.Compared to the research of tiltrotor internationally, further research is needed. The conclusionof the paper provide some reference to the researching on tiltrotor in our country.
